On This Page:Amarillo Travel Guide
The commercial center of the Texas Panhandle, Amarillo arose when the Fort Worth and Denver City Railway started laying track in the area in 1887, a decade after ranchers began to graze their cattle on the buffalo grass-speckled plains. When the town was formally incorporated, the name Amarillomeaning "yellow" literally and "wild horse" figurativelywas adopted from a nearby lake. In a little over a decade, the combination of the railroad and the ranchland led to the establishment of Amarillo's long-standing status as a cattle-shipping capital. To this day, the city "smells like money" most when the Amarillo Livestock Auction is in full swing.
